Former second Vice President of the Jamaica Civil Service Association, JCSA, Gillian Corrodus, says she’s facing slander from some members within the Association in the race for the next President.
The first set of voting is underway at electoral offices across the island.
They begun this morning at 8AM.
Another round of voting is scheduled to take place at electoral offices in Kingston and St. Andrew on May 26.
Ms. Corrodus says members of the JCSA should rise up against, what she calls, tyranny in the Association.

She says a discussion has not been held on the matter to date with those responsible.
Meanwhile, President of the Jamaica Civil Service Association, JCSA, O’Neil Grant says he is not aware of any tyranny in the association.
Mr. Grant says Ms. Corrodus should bring her issues to him so he can handle the matter.
Mr. Grant says Ms. Corrodus’ campaign has been to attack the JCSA.
